What Are Peptides?
Peptides are short chains of amino acids that act as biological messengers, helping regulate processes such as tissue repair, collagen production, wound healing, and cellular communication. Certain peptides are being studied for their potential to support healthier hair follicles and scalp function.
Unlike larger proteins, peptides can interact efficiently with specific receptors in the body. In dermatology and regenerative medicine, they are commonly used in topical formulations and injectable therapies because of their regenerative properties.
For hair restoration, peptides do not create new hair follicles. Instead, they aim to improve the environment surrounding existing follicles, helping them function more effectively.
How Do Peptides Help with Hair Loss?
Peptides may help hair loss by supporting cellular communication, reducing inflammation, encouraging tissue repair, and creating a healthier environment for hair follicles. Their primary role is to improve the function of existing follicles rather than generate new ones.
Hair follicles naturally cycle through periods of growth, transition, and rest. Conditions such as androgenetic alopecia, aging, hormonal changes, or inflammation can shorten the growth phase, causing hair to become progressively thinner.
Researchers believe certain peptides may help by:
- Supporting cellular repair
- Encouraging growth factor activity
- Improving scalp health
- Stimulating collagen production
- Reducing oxidative stress around follicles

Which Types of Peptides Are Used for Hair Growth?
Copper peptides, particularly GHK-Cu (glycyl-L-histidyl-L-lysine copper), are among the most extensively researched peptides for hair restoration. Human studies suggest they may support healthier hair follicles by promoting tissue repair, reducing inflammation, stimulating collagen production, and creating an environment that supports healthy hair growth.
Among them, GHK-Cu has received significant attention in regenerative medicine because of its potential to:
- Support tissue repair and wound healing
- Reduce inflammation around hair follicles
- Stimulate collagen and extracellular matrix production
- Encourage healthy blood vessel formation (angiogenesis)
- Promote healthier hair follicle function

How Do Peptides Compare with Other Hair Loss Treatments?
Peptides primarily support scalp health and follicle function, making them most suitable for early-stage hair thinning. They are generally considered a complementary therapy rather than a replacement for established medical or surgical treatments.
| Treatment | Best For | How It Works |
| Peptides | Early-stage thinning | Supports cellular signaling and scalp health |
| Platelet Mesotherapy (PMT) | Mild to moderate hair loss | Uses concentrated platelets and growth factors to stimulate follicles |
| Hair Serums | Pattern hair loss | Slows follicle miniaturization and prolongs the growth phase |
| DHI Hair Transplant | Advanced hair loss | Restores hair by transplanting healthy grafts |
Unlike medications that target hormonal pathways or surgical procedures that restore missing hair, peptides work by improving the biological environment surrounding existing follicles.

Who May Benefit from Peptide Therapy?
Peptide therapy may benefit patients with early hair thinning, weakened follicles, or those undergoing regenerative treatments such as PMT.
Patients with early androgenetic alopecia, mild diffuse thinning, or age-related reduction in hair density may experience the greatest benefit. Peptides are less likely to restore hair in areas where follicles have permanently disappeared or in patients with significant scarring alopecia.
Because hair loss may result from hormonal disorders, nutritional deficiencies, autoimmune disease, or other medical conditions, a professional evaluation is essential before beginning treatment.
